Ive played Tekken from the first Playstation till Tekken 5. So I am not new to this game, in fact I'm really good at it.
I will start with the bad part because its short. The worst part of the game is when the end boss is so hard, that if you take a single hit, you are basically finished, it kinda takes away from the fun factor of the game. If you block, he can stun you. If you attack, he dodges. If you start learning his moves, he changes accordingly. And with an attack that does about 90% damage in a single hit with about a 1 second delay, its no fun. If you dodge, he can fire another one right after the first. So basically, you have to beat him as fast as possible without guarding and pray he doesn't use his death move.
Now the end boss was the only part of the game I really didn't like, Unless you buy a gameshark and put the code in to unlock. Luckily you can't unlock him while playing the game normally.
Now for the good parts, like Character movements and attacks are more smooth then previous games. The graphics are slightly higher then 4, and obviously alot better then Tekken 1 - 3. Tekken 5 also has a kinda of cool character customization feature where you can buy items for characters, and customize colors of 3 sections.
They added a new feature called "Tekken : Devil Within". Its the story of Jin's past. Basically you play as Jin and go through levels beating enemies. Its kinda hard because of the controls and camera angles. Basically you get a single button for kicking, punching, blocking, and jumping. Then the analog stick for moving. Its slightly fun for the first time, but when you die, it becomes kinda boring. Though, a friend of mine loved it and thats all he did. It just depends on what you like. Its more like a Third Person Fighter.
My all time favorite thing they added was an arcade mode. It has Tekken 1, 2, and 3 in arcade style. You have most of the characters unlocked in each game right from the start. But, it is the arcade version so theres no menu's and options. You just get the basic game, which is fine with me.
All in all, this game is good, but I feel the end boss alone made it a game that has a lower replay value, which may be the reason they added the arcade mode. I find it hard for myself to play through the story because of this, and thats a large part of the game. But if you can beat it, the stories are interesting. Much like Tekken 2, which is my favorite. If you can find a strategy for beating the end boss, then this game would rival Tekken 2. Like all fighting games of course, you just have to find a weak point.
